How many MW of battery energy storage will be deployed in Buenos Aires?
The initiative aims to deploy 500 MW of battery energy storage systems (BESS) in the Greater Buenos Aires Area (GBA), but the submitted capacity has far exceeded expectations—reaching a combined 1,347 MW

What does the almagba tender mean for Argentina?
The AlmaGBA tender not only signals growing investor confidence in Argentina’s energy transition but also sets the stage for grid resilience and renewable integration. Evaluation of submissions is now underway, with final selections expected to shape the country’s storage landscape for years to come.
